Alaska Native Village Municipal Lands Restoration Act of 2025

Key claim: The Alaska Native Village Municipal Lands Restoration Act of 2025 (Public Law 119-23) removes the ANCSA requirement that Alaska Native village corporations convey certain lands to municipalities or to the State of Alaska in trust, and allows village corporations and residents to dissolve those trusts and regain title by formal resolution.

Abstract

(HR43 · 119th Congress) Alaska Native Village Municipal Lands Restoration Act of 2025 This act removes the requirement that Alaska Native village corporations must convey lands to Alaska to be held in trust for future municipal governments. The Alaska Native Claims Settlement Act (ANCSA) requires all Alaska Native village corporations that receive land under the ANCSA to convey certain lands to the existing municipality in the village or, if no municipality exists, to Alaska in trust for any municipality that may be established in the future. This act removes the requirement for conveyance. Additionally, the act allows village corporations to regain title to the lands held in trust by dissolving the trust through formal resolution by the village corporation and the residents of the Native village. Latest action (2025-07-07): Became Public Law No: 119-23.

Why this matters

The Act rewrites a longstanding ANCSA land-tenure requirement, shifting title authority over village lands from municipalities and the State of Alaska back to Alaska Native village corporations and residents. For land use, this changes who controls zoning-eligible, developable acreage in village areas and creates a formal dissolution pathway for existing trusts, potentially affecting local housing development and municipal service planning in affected communities.
